# Java判断科学计数 科学计数是一种用于表示非常大或非常小的数值的方法,它由两部分组成:尾数和指数。尾数是一个小于10的数字,指数是一个整数。对于科学计数表示的数,尾数乘以10的指数次幂就是它的实际值。 在Java中,我们可以使用正则表达式来判断一个字符串是否符合科学计数的格式。下面我们将介绍如何使用Java代码来实现这一功能。 ## 步骤一:导入正则表达式类库 在Java中,
原创 2023-11-20 05:46:09
106阅读
1024 科学计数 (20分)科学计数科学家用来表示很大或很小的数字的一种方便的方法,其满足正则表达式 [±][1-9].[0-9]+E[±][0-9]+,即数字的整数部分只有 1 位,小数部分至少有 1 位,该数字及其指数部分的正负号即使对正数也必定明确给出。 现以科学计数的格式给出实数 A,请编写程序按普通数字表示输出 A,并保证所有有效位都被保留。输入格式:每个输入包含 1 个测试
Math类基本常用方法Math类中的方法都是静态的,只能通过类名访问。double a,b; Math.abs(a);//返回a的绝对值 Math.sqrt(a);//返回a的平方根 Math.pow(a,b);//返回a的b次方的值 Math.max(a,b);//返回a,b中的最大值 Math.min(a,b);//返回a,b中的最小值 Math.random();//返回[0~1)的随机数
转载 2023-09-22 11:01:15
155阅读
# Java判断数值是否为科学计数 在编程中,我们经常需要处理各种数值,其中科学计数是一种常见的数值表示方式。科学计数能够方便地表示非常大或非常小的数值。在Java中,我们可以通过一些方法来判断一个数值是否为科学计数。本文将介绍如何使用Java判断数值是否为科学计数,并提供相应的代码示例。 ## 什么是科学计数 科学计数是一种表示非常大或非常小的数值的方式,其基本形式为`a×
原创 2024-07-20 06:20:09
31阅读
# Java判断科学计数并转换 ## 一、流程梳理 ```mermaid journey title Java判断科学计数并转换 section 确认输入 判断输入是否为科学计数 判断输入是否为合法的科学计数 section 转换 提取科学计数中的底数和指数 根据底数和指数计算出完整的数字 ```
原创 2024-07-02 04:49:40
39阅读
# Java判断数字是科学计数 ## 介绍 在Java中,判断一个数字是否为科学计数需要考虑多种情况。本文将介绍判断数字是科学计数的流程,并提供相应的代码示例来帮助你理解和实现这一功能。 ## 流程图 下面是判断数字是否为科学计数的整体流程图。 ```mermaid journey title 判断数字是否为科学计数 section 输入数字 section
原创 2023-10-06 04:44:01
355阅读
# 判断类型为科学计数 Java ## 1. 流程 以下是判断类型为科学计数Java代码的流程: | 步骤 | 描述 | | --- | --- | | 1 | 输入一个数值 | | 2 | 判断是否为科学计数 | | 3 | 输出判断结果 | ## 2. 代码示例 ### 步骤1:输入一个数值 ```java Scanner scanner = new Scanner(Sys
原创 2024-03-18 03:22:30
45阅读
当使用POI处理excel的时候,遇到了比较长的数字,虽然excel里面设置该单元格是文本类型的,但是POI的cell的类型就会变成数字类型。 而且无论数字是否小数,使用cell.getNumbericCellValue() 去获取值的时候,会得到一个double,而且当长度大一点的时候会变成科学计数形式。 那么获取这个单元格的原始的数据,就其实是一个double怎么转换成整
转载 1月前
436阅读
基本数据类型和表达式 1.      八进制以0开头,十六进制以0x开头。2.      科学计数:1.23E(e)5→→→1.23*1053.      转义序列:\’,\”,\\,\n(换行),\r(回车
Java程序中总是会出现一些数字。我们通常都是用常规的方式来表示这些数字,如以下代码所示 int a = 1; double b = 1.5; 但是数字也可以有非常规写法,在这里我们用一篇短文简单总结一下整数的非十进制写法首先强调一下,这里所说的整数并不是单指int类型,而是包含了int、byte、short和long这4种整数类型。在Java语言中,除了可以用十进制的形式表示整数
# 判断合法的科学计数Java实现 科学计数是一种在科学和工程中常用的表示数值的方式,特别是当数值很大或很小时。这种表示方法通常采用形式 `a × 10^b`,其中 `a` 是一个小数,`b` 是一个整数。为了在编程中处理科学计数的字符串表示,我们需要验证其合法性,并将其转换为相应的数值。 ## 什么是科学计数科学计数通过将一个数字表示为整数或小数部分乘以 10 的幂,来简化
原创 8月前
47阅读
# Java判断是否是科学计数 科学计数是一种用于表示大数或小数的方法,常用于科学领域和工程领域。在Java中,我们可以使用正则表达式来判断一个字符串是否符合科学计数的格式。 ## 什么是科学计数 科学计数是一种用简明扼要的方式表示非常大或非常小的数字的方法。它的基本形式为a×10^b,其中a是一个十进制小数或整数,b是一个整数。 举个例子,1.23 × 10^6表示1.23乘以
原创 2024-01-28 09:08:29
77阅读
## 判断是不是科学计数Java中,科学计数是一种表示浮点数的方法,通常用于处理非常大或非常小的数值。科学计数的表示形式为“数字E指数”,例如1.23E4表示1.23乘以10的4次方。在实际开发过程中,我们经常需要判断一个字符串是否符合科学计数的格式。下面我们来看看如何在Java判断一个字符串是否是科学计数。 ### 判断逻辑 判断一个字符串是否是科学计数,通常需要满足以下
原创 2024-05-06 04:12:16
73阅读
# Java 判断字符串是否为科学计数 科学计数是一种在数学和科学中常见的数字表达方式,用于表示非常大或非常小的数值。它通常的形式为 `a × 10^b`,其中 `a` 是一个数字,`b` 是一个整数。在 Java 中,判断一个字符串是否符合科学计数的格式,对数据的处理和转换非常重要。本文将介绍如何在 Java 中实现这一功能,并通过代码示例加以说明。 ## 科学计数的格式 科学计数
原创 2024-08-08 16:51:19
63阅读
一、题目科学计数科学家用来表示很大或很小的数字的一种方便的方法,其满足正则表达式 [+-][1-9].[0-9]+E[+-][0-9]+,即数字的整数部分只有 1 位,小数部分至少有 1 位,该数字及其指数部分的正负号即使对正数也必定明确给出。现以科学计数的格式给出实数 A,请编写程序按普通数字表示输出 A,并保证所有有效位都被保留。输入格式:每个输入包含 1 个测试用
转载 2023-07-11 17:20:27
273阅读
科学计数使用e标识数值,将科学计算学转化为数字的思路:按e右边的数字移动小数点位数。e右边的数字如果是负数,则向左移动小数点。示例如下:1.2345678e2 = 123.45678 1.2345678e-2 = 0.012345678 1.7615562e+06 = 1761556.2 1.87982e7 = 18798200 1e3 = 1000那么在shell中,如何转化科学计数为数字呢
# Python正则判断科学计数实现方法 ## 引言 作为一名经验丰富的开发者,我将会教会你如何使用Python正则表达式来判断科学计数。在本文中,我将会展示整个流程,并为你提供每一步所需的代码和解释。 ## 流程概述 下面是实现“Python正则判断科学计数”的流程概述,我们将通过这些步骤来完成任务。 | 步骤 | 描述 | | ----- | ------ | | 1 | 导入r
原创 2024-03-28 04:50:05
441阅读
计算机是怎么存小数的?1000.101 这种二进制小数是「定点数」形式,代表着小数点是定死的,不能移动,如果你移动了它的小数点,这个数就变了, 就不再是它原来的值了。然而,计算机并不是这样存储的小数的,计算机存储小数的采用的是浮点数,名字里的「浮点」表示小数点是可以浮动的,比如 1000.101 这个二进制数,可以表示成 1.000101 x 2^(-3),
转载 2023-10-09 23:40:38
181阅读
科学计数表示的数是double类型,不要认为是int类型jshell>56789/1e5$1==>0.56789jshell>56789/100000$2==>0jshell>1e5$3==>100000.0
1e5
原创 2017-12-29 14:11:26
4477阅读
# 科学计数Java中的应用 在日常生活和工作中,我们经常会遇到很大或很小的数字,如果直接使用普通的数字类型来表示,可能会造成精度丢失或者数据过于庞大。这时,科学计数就派上了用场。科学计数是一种用来表示很大或很小的数字的方法,通常以一个底数乘以10的幂的形式表示。在Java中,我们可以通过一些工具类来方便地处理科学计数的数字。 ## 什么是科学计数 科学计数是一种方便地表示很大
原创 2024-06-15 03:56:55
180阅读
  • 1
  • 2
  • 3
  • 4
  • 5